CentOS Web Panel - OS Command Injection
ID: CVE-2021-31324
Severity: critical
Author: ritikchaddha
Tags: cve,cve2021,centos,cwpsrv,os,rce
Description
Section titled “Description”The unprivileged user portal part of CentOS Web Panel is affected by a Command Injection vulnerability leading to root Remote Code Execution.
